搭建 Java Web 开发环境

腾讯云
入门
0 个任务
剩余 3 个名额

你还可以 创建 或者 使用已有 云主机不限时上机

实验内容

学习如何搭建 Java 和 Tomcat 组成的 Java Web 开发环境

首次可免费使用云主机 45 分钟 ,到期后云主机将被重置并退库,若想保留成果请及时留用。

实验资源

云服务器

软件环境

CentOS 6.8 64 位

目录

# 搭建 Java Web 开发环境 ## 搭建 Java 开发环境 > <time>18min ~ 20min</time> 此实验教大家如何配置 JDK 、Tomcat 和 Mysql ### 安装 JDK JDK 是开发Java程序必须安装的软件,我们查看一下 `yum` 源里面的 JDK: ``` yum list java* ``` 选择适合本机的JDK,并安装: ``` yum install java-1.7.0-openjdk* -y ``` 安装完成后,查看是否安装成功: ``` java -version ``` > <checker type="output-contains" command="which java" hint="JDK 未安装"> > <keyword regex="/usr/bin/java" /> > </checker> ### 安装 Tomcat Tomcat 是一个应用服务器,是开发和调试 jsp 程序的首选,可以利用它来响应 HTML 页面的访问请求。 进入本地文件夹 ``` cd /usr/local ``` 到官网找到 Tomcat 的下载链接,并下载到服务器中, 这里提供了一个快速下载 Tomcat 的地址: ``` wget https://mc.qcloudimg.com/static/archive/fa66329388f85c08e8d6c12ceb8b2ca3/apache-tomcat-7.0.77.tar.gz ``` 解压这个文件夹: ``` tar -zxf apache-tomcat-7.0.77.tar.gz ``` 重命名这个文件[:question][rename-folder]: ``` mv apache-tomcat-7.0.77 /usr/local/tomcat7 ``` 进入 bin 文件夹 ``` cd /usr/local/tomcat7/bin ``` 给这个文件夹下的所有 shell 脚本授予权限: ``` chmod 777 *.sh ``` 开启tomcat服务: ``` ./startup.sh ``` > <bubble for="rename-folder"> > 重命名是为了方便后续操作, 并非必须步骤 > </bubble> > <checker type="output-contains" command="netstat -nlpt" hint="Tomcat 进程未启动"> > <keyword regex="java" /> > </checker> ### 安装 MySQL 使用 `yum` 安装 MySQL: ``` yum install -y mysql-server mysql mysql-devel ``` 安装完成后,启动 MySQL 服务: ``` service mysqld restart ``` 设置 MySQL 账户 root 密码:[:question][password] ``` /usr/bin/mysqladmin -u root password '${runtime.vars.allocatedPassword}' ``` > <bubble for="password"> > 下面命令中的密码是教程为您自动生成的,为了方便实验的进行,不建议使用其它密码。如果设置其它密码,请把密码记住。 > </bubble> > <checker type="output-contains" command="ls /usr/bin" hint="MySQL 未安装"> > <keyword regex="mysql" /> > </checker> > <checker type="output-contains" command="mysql -u root --password=${runtime.vars.allocatedPassword} -e &quot;select 'success' as ''&quot;" hint="使用生成的密码无法连接 MySQL,如果你已使用自己的密码完成了设置,请直接进入下一步。"> > <keyword regex="success" /> > </checker> ## 访问 Tomcat > <time>3min ~ 5min</time> ### 访问 Tomcat 此时,访问 [http://${runtime.vars.cvmIpAddress}:8080][] 可访问到刚才启动的 Tomcat 的内置示例页面 > <checker type="output-contains" command="curl http://${runtime.vars.cvmIpAddress}:8080/ --silent" hint="启动 tomcat 试玩 Java 示例程序。"> > <keyword regex="tomcat" /> > </checker> ### 完成实验 恭喜!您已经成功完成了搭建 Java Web 开发环境的实验任务。